Impossible de masquer widget forum

Voir le sujet précédent Voir le sujet suivant Aller en bas

Résolu Impossible de masquer widget forum

Message par Outis le Mar 2 Sep 2014 - 22:17

Bonjour,

J'ai ajouté un widget sur mon forum et jusqu'à hier, je savais le masquer en suivant ce tuto.
Mais ce soir, je ne sais pas ce qui s'est passé, cela ne semble plus fonctionner.

J'ai pourtant veillé à restaurer les templates (des fois que ça viendrait de là) et il ne reste rien dans le CSS sauf le code donné dans le tuto.

Une idée d'où pourrait venir le problème ?

Merci pour toute aide.

Forum phpbb2 : http://personofintetest.weshforum.com/forum
Template : non modifié
CSS : modifié




Dernière édition par Outis le Mer 3 Sep 2014 - 12:32, édité 1 fois

Outis
*****

Messages : 554
Inscrit(e) le : 28/07/2012

http://personofinterest.fra.co
Outis a été remercié(e) par l'auteur de ce sujet.

Résolu Re: Impossible de masquer widget forum

Message par Kinotto le Mer 3 Sep 2014 - 8:33

Bonjour,

Avez-vous bien ajouté le script sur toutes les pages correspondant à votre version ?


Cordialement.

Kinotto
+ Hyperactif +

Masculin
Messages : 2177
Inscrit(e) le : 12/09/2012

http://test-nightmare.superforum.fr/
Kinotto a été remercié(e) par l'auteur de ce sujet.

Résolu Re: Impossible de masquer widget forum

Message par Outis le Mer 3 Sep 2014 - 11:29

Oui.
Ce qui est étrange, c'est que cela fonctionnait bien jusqu'à hier. Et sans avoir touché au script (toujours daté du 21/08), cela ne fonctionne plus.
J'ai repris le CSS du tuto dans le doute mais sans obtenir de meilleur résultat.

Sur toutes les pages :
Code:
$(function() {
          var c = $("#left,#right"), d, e = function() {
            var a = $(this).data("side");
            window.localStorage && localStorage[("none" == $("#" + a).parent().css("display") ? "remove" : "set") + "Item"]("wid" + a, "1");
            $("#" + a).parent().toggle();
            $(this).toggleClass("isopened isclosed")
          };
          c.length && ($("#content-container").prepend(d = $('<div id="widget-arrows"><div style="clear:both"></div></div>')), c.each(function() {
            var a = $(this).attr("id"), b = $('<div class="widget-arrow is' + a + ' isopened"></div>');
            b.data("side", a).appendTo(d).click(e);
            window.localStorage && "1" == localStorage.getItem("wid" + a) && b.trigger("click")
          }))
        });

le seul code qu'on trouve sur le CSS (nettoyé pour vérification)
Code:
        #widget-arrows {
          height: 13px;
        }
        .widget-arrow {
          height: 13px;
          width: 16px;
          border-radius: 4px;
          float: left;
          cursor: pointer;
          background: #f5ebf7 url(http://i.imgur.com/zVQMs.png) no-repeat 0 -13px;
        }
        .widget-arrow.isright {
          float: right;
        }
        .widget-arrow.isleft.isclosed, .widget-arrow.isright.isopened {
          background-position: 0 0;
        }

Outis
*****

Messages : 554
Inscrit(e) le : 28/07/2012

http://personofinterest.fra.co
Outis a été remercié(e) par l'auteur de ce sujet.

Résolu Re: Impossible de masquer widget forum

Message par Kinotto le Mer 3 Sep 2014 - 11:59

Pouvez-vous vérifier que la gestion des JS est bien activée ? Vous auriez pu la désactiver par inadvertance.


Cordialement.

Kinotto
+ Hyperactif +

Masculin
Messages : 2177
Inscrit(e) le : 12/09/2012

http://test-nightmare.superforum.fr/
Kinotto a été remercié(e) par l'auteur de ce sujet.

Résolu Re: Impossible de masquer widget forum

Message par Outis le Mer 3 Sep 2014 - 12:32

Non, ce n'était pas ça puisque de toute façon tous les autres script fonctionnaient et que je n'ai jamais touché à celui-là depuis sa création.

Visiblement, il y avait un conflit avec un autre code, mais j'ignore lequel. En ayant tout supprimé, le problème s'est corrigé. Ce n'était pas la solution idéale mais au moins ça fonctionne (reste plus qu'à remettre tous les codes ^^)

Merci pour ton aide Wink

Outis
*****

Messages : 554
Inscrit(e) le : 28/07/2012

http://personofinterest.fra.co
Outis a été remercié(e) par l'auteur de ce sujet.

Voir le sujet précédent Voir le sujet suivant Revenir en haut


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um